(specifically titled Cinemax Sessions: Fats Domino & Friends: Immortal Keyboards of Rock & Roll ) is a historic 1986 concert special. The performance is widely celebrated as the first and only time three of the most influential rock 'n' roll piano legends— Fats Domino , Jerry Lee Lewis , and Ray Charles —shared the stage together. The show was hosted and musically directed by Paul Shaffer (from Late Night with David Letterman ) and featured Ron Wood of the Rolling Stones on guitar. Program Setlist Go to product viewer dialog for this item
While each artist performed solo sets of their hits, the highlight was a collaborative jam session. A notable moment from rehearsals involved a debate over which key to play "Jambalaya" in; Fats Domino famously insisted he only played it in D-flat .
